Entree: Uzbekistan – Fergana Valley – Kazan Kabob (Hearty Uzbek lamb and potato stew braised in a kazan with onions, tomatoes, and warm spices)

Kazan Kabob recipe
Serving Size: 4
Approximate Time
Prep 25 min
Cook 2 hrs
Total 2 hrs 25 min

Ingredients

- 2 lb (900 g) lamb shoulder, trimmed and cut into 1½-inch (4 cm) pieces
- 3 tbsp (45 ml) vegetable oil
- 3 large onions, sliced, approx. 18 oz (510 g)
- 4 medium potatoes, peeled and cut into large wedges, approx. 2 lb (900 g)
- 2 large tomatoes, diced, approx. 12 oz (340 g)
- 4 cloves garlic, minced, approx. 12 g
- 1 tbsp (15 ml) tomato paste
- 1 tsp (2 g) ground cumin
- 1 tsp (2 g) ground coriander
- 1 tsp (2 g) smoked paprika
- 1 tsp (5 g) kosher salt, adjust to taste
- 1/2 tsp (1 g) freshly ground black pepper
- 2 bay leaves
- 1 cup (240 ml) beef or lamb broth (or water)
- 2 tbsp (30 g) chopped fresh cilantro for finishing
- Lemon or lime wedges for serving

Instructions

1. Heat 2 tbsp (30 ml) vegetable oil in a large heavy-bottomed pot or kazan over medium-high heat. Season the lamb pieces with salt and pepper. Working in batches if needed, brown the lamb on all sides, 6–8 minutes per batch; transfer browned pieces to a plate.
2. Reduce heat to medium, add remaining 1 tbsp (15 ml) oil to the pot, then add the sliced onions. Cook, stirring occasionally, until deep golden and caramelized, about 12–15 minutes. Add the minced garlic, tomato paste, cumin, coriander, and paprika; cook 1–2 minutes until fragrant.
3. Stir in the diced tomatoes and return the lamb to the pot. Add the bay leaves and pour in the broth so it comes about halfway up the meat. Bring to a simmer, cover, and reduce heat to low; braise for 45 minutes.
4. Add the potato wedges to the pot, nestling them among the meat, and continue to braise, covered, until both meat and potatoes are tender, about 30–45 more minutes. Check liquid level and add up to 1/2 cup (120 ml) water if needed to prevent burning.
5. Remove the lid, increase heat to medium-high, and reduce the sauce for 5–10 minutes if it is too thin. Taste and adjust salt and pepper. Stir in chopped cilantro and serve with lemon or lime wedges alongside flatbread or rice.
